How much do assistant project manager data center j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 2, 2026, the average yearly pay for assistant project manager data center in Bothell, WA is $81,676.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$59,800.00 and $98,400.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does an Assistant Project Manager do in a data center project?

An Assistant Project Manager in a data center project supports the Project Manager in planning, coordinating, and overseeing all aspects of the construction or upgrade process. Their responsibilities often include assisting with scheduling, budgeting, procurement, documentation, and communication between contractors, vendors, and stakeholders. They help ensure that the project stays on track, meets deadlines, and complies with safety and quality standards. This role typically requires strong organizational, communication, and problem-solving skills, as well as some technical knowledge of data center infrastructure.

What are some common challenges faced by Assistant Project Managers in data center projects, and how can they overcome them?

Assistant Project Managers in data center projects often face challenges such as coordinating between multiple stakeholders, managing tight project timelines, and adapting to rapidly changing technical requirements. Success in this role often depends on strong communication skills, attention to detail, and a proactive approach to problem-solving. Building relationships with vendors, maintaining thorough documentation, and staying updated on the latest industry standards can help overcome these hurdles and keep projects on track. Regular check-ins with the project team and clear reporting can also ensure that everyone is aligned throughout the project lifecycle.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Assistant Project Manager Data Center,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Assistant Project Manager Data Center, you need a solid understanding of project management principles, data center infrastructure, and construction processes, often supported by a bachelor's degree in engineering or a related field. Familiarity with project management software (such as MS Project or Primavera), AutoCAD, and industry certifications like PMP or CAPM is typically required. Strong organization, problem-solving, and interpersonal communication skills help coordinate stakeholders and manage project timelines effectively. These competencies are crucial for ensuring projects are delivered on schedule, within budget, and to the technical standards required in the data center industry.

Job description

The position of Assistant Project Manager for our Commercial Group is responsible for providing a high level of coordination support in a variety of areas, partnering with construction project management and field staff.
  1. Assist with managing all aspects of project documentation including submittals, RFIs and project meeting minutes.
  2. Assist with supervision and directing project activities as assigned by the PM including planning and coordinating, circumventing/resolving problem areas, ensuring all company/project policies, procedures and standards are maintained, etc.
  3. Assist with the maintenance of all change order, submittal and document control logs within Viewpoint.
  4. Assist PM and PX with interactions with subcontractors to make certain that we have obtained the correct documentation and drawing for the Owner and Maintenance Manuals.
  5. Responsible for creating the Job Information Sheets and establishing job files under the direction of the PM or PX.
  6. Assume temporary total project supervision responsibilities in the absence of the PM.
  7. Able to read and basic understanding of electrical drawings and specifications.
  8. Assist with establishing workflow breakdowns in conjunction with Field Supervisors and Project Managers.
  9. Assist with ensuring project billings are accurate and submitted timely, monthly, and per contract documents.
  10. Responsible for assisting in writing and submission of quality RFIs.
  11. Responsible for assisting PM to ensure timely payment to subcontractors and vendors.
  12. Able to review and update status of construction schedules as per request of PM or PX.
  13. Able to assist Project Management team with the setup of project budgets in Viewpoint in conjunction with Field Supervisor.
  14. Work with Payroll department to ensure accurate Payroll information has been submitted.
  15. Other duties as assigned.
